Oilers and Maple Leafs Navigate Trade Deadline Dynamics Amid Injuries

As the NHL’s trade deadline approaches, the Edmonton Oilers are facing a notable injury concern that could influence their short-term roster decisions. Forward Ryan Nugent-Hopkins is currently listed day-to-day with an undisclosed injury, leading to questions regarding his availability for upcoming games.

What the Team Reported

The Oilers announced that Nugent-Hopkins did not participate in the team’s most recent practice session on Wednesday. Head Coach Jay Woodcroft indicated that his status would be evaluated further as the team readies for its next matchup. Importantly, no specifics were given concerning the nature of the injury or a timeline for possible return.

Immediate Roster Implications

Nugent-Hopkins has been an integral part of the Oilers’ forward lines this season, typically positioned within their top two lines. In his absence, the team is likely to shuffle its line combinations. Players such as Jesse Puljujarvi or Kailer Yamamoto could see increased ice time as they slot into higher positions.

Defensively, the lineup remains stable, as Nugent-Hopkins primarily contributes to offensive plays. However, his absence may affect special teams, particularly the power play, where he often contributes significantly. The Oilers will need to adapt quickly to mitigate any disruption.
